This men's leather brogue shoe is a dress shoe designed in Canada and exclusive to Simons. It features a genuine leather upper with a polished finish, classic wingtip brogue perforations, closed oxford lacing, and a padded footbed. Key specifications include an embossed non-skid rubber outer sole, stacked heel, black insole with Simons branding, and accessories such as signature storage bags and an additional pair of laces.

After-wear care

Insert unvarnished cedar shoe trees after each wear and store in the supplied cotton bags.

Why this is supported

The after-wear care recommended includes

Inserting unvarnished cedar shoe trees after each wear not only absorbs excess moisture but also maintains the shape of the brogues, reducing vamp creasing that can cause the polished finish to flake or crack prematurely—an especially important step for keeping the high-shine surface intact across the toe flex zone.Caring for polished leather brogues — cedar_shoe_trees

Then, the shoes should be stored in the provided bags:

Storing the brogues in the supplied signature cotton bags after a light dusting shields the polished surface from airborne dust that settles and dims the shine, while the breathable fabric prevents moisture buildup that could cause mold spotting on the leatherCaring for polished leather brogues — storage_in_signature_bags

— these steps prevent moisture and dust damage, preserving the polished finish between wears.

Polishing

Apply cream polish to maintain the brogue pattern; reserve wax for toe and heel.

Why this is supported

The research recommends a two-tier polishing approach:

a cream polish nourishes the leather and imparts a soft glow without building up in the holesCaring for polished leather brogues — cream_polish_vs_wax_polish_for_brogues

Meanwhile, wax polish should be used sparingly only on the toe cap and heel counter to achieve a mirror shine without clogging the brogue perforations.

a wax polish should be used sparingly only on the toe cap and heel counter to achieve a mirror shine without clogging the brogueingCaring for polished leather brogues — cream_polish_vs_wax_polish_for_brogues
Pre-polish cleaning

Wipe brogues with a barely damp cloth before polishing to prevent micro-scratches.

Why this is supported

Before polishing, removing surface grit prevents damage:

Wiping polished leather with a barely damp cotton cloth before polishing removes surface grit that would otherwise abrade the glossy upper during brushing or buffing, preventing micro-scratches that dull the high-shine appearance over time.Caring for polished leather brogues — gentle_pre_polish_cleaning
